Understanding the Camera's Autofocus System
The Canon Rebel SL3 is equipped with a responsive autofocus system that is essential for capturing sharp images of fast subjects. Its Dual Pixel CMOS AF technology allows for quick and accurate focusing, even when subjects are moving unpredictably. To maximize autofocus performance, use the AI Servo AF mode, which continuously adjusts focus as the subject moves.
Sample Shots and Settings for Action Photography
Below are descriptions of sample shots taken with the Canon Rebel SL3, along with recommended settings to achieve similar results.
Sample Shot 1: Sports Action
This shot captures a runner mid-stride during a race. The camera was set to AI Servo AF, with a shutter speed of 1/2000 sec to freeze motion. The ISO was increased to 800 to compensate for indoor lighting, and a wide aperture (f/4) was used to isolate the subject against a blurred background.
Sample Shot 2: Wildlife in Motion
In this photo, a bird is captured in flight. The camera's burst mode was activated to take multiple shots rapidly. Settings included a shutter speed of 1/4000 sec, aperture f/5.6, and ISO 400. Continuous autofocus tracking kept the bird in focus as it moved across the frame.
Techniques for Better Results
To improve your chances of capturing sharp images of fast-moving subjects, consider the following techniques:
- Use a high shutter speed (at least 1/2000 sec) to freeze motion.
- Enable continuous autofocus (AI Servo AF) for dynamic focusing.
- Utilize burst mode to take multiple shots in quick succession.
- Adjust ISO settings to maintain proper exposure while using fast shutter speeds.
- Practice panning with the moving subject to create a sense of motion with a sharp subject and blurred background.
